OpenNebula logo OpenNebula

OpenNebula is an Open Source Cloud & Edge Computing Platform to build & manage Enterprise Clouds. OpenNebula provides unified management of IT infrastructure, avoiding vendor lock-in & reducing complexity, resource consumption, & operational costs ๐Ÿš€

LoopFuse logo LoopFuse

LoopFuse OneView is sales and marketing automation software that makes it easy for companies to increase sales and marketing effectiveness, shorten sales cycle, and helps to acquire better leads and more revenue.

Analysis of LoopFuse

Overall verdict

  • LoopFuse was a marketing automation and lead management platform that gained attention for offering a free tier of its software, making it accessible to small businesses; however, it is important to note that LoopFuse as a standalone active product is largely defunct or has been absorbed into other offerings over the years, so its current relevance and support are questionable.

Why this product is good

  • Historically offered a free version of marketing automation tools, lowering the barrier to entry for small businesses.
  • Provided lead scoring and email marketing integration features useful for sales and marketing alignment.
  • Simple setup compared to some enterprise-level marketing automation suites.
  • Included basic CRM integration capabilities for tracking leads.

Recommended for

  • Small businesses historically seeking free or low-cost marketing automation (if still accessible).
  • Users researching legacy marketing automation tools for reference.
  • Not recommended for businesses seeking actively supported, modern marketing automation platforms.

What are some alternatives?

When comparing OpenNebula and LoopFuse, you can also consider the following products

VMmanager - VMmanager is a QEMU/KVM server virtualization management software, which presents perfect tools for creating virtual machines, providing VPS services, and building cloud infrastructure.

OpenStack - OpenStack software controls large pools of compute, storage, and networking resources throughout a datacenter, managed through a dashboard or via the OpenStack API.

Virtkick - Virtkick is a Software as a Service VPS control panel and your companyโ€™s storefront.

Apache CloudStack - CloudStack is an open source cloud computing software for creating, managing, and deploying infrastructure cloud services.

Proxmox VE - Proxmox is an open-source server virtualization management solution that offers the ability to manage virtual server technology with the Linux OpenVZ and KVM technology.

XCP-ng - A fully open source and community backed alternative, with all current commercial features enabled...
